Entry Requirements Irish Leaving Certificate
96 UCAS tariff points to include a minimum of five subjects (four of which must be at higher level) to include English at H6 if studied at Higher level or O4 if studied at Ordinary Level.

Assessment Method Assessment strategies include essays, presentations, performances, literature reviews, dissertations, workshop demonstrations, creative writing, reflective essays and vivas, portfolios, and websites. Assessment strategies are constructively aligned with learning outcomes for the module and programme overall. While there are a relatively small number of summative assessments for any module (normally two, a maximum of three), these are supported by a range of opportunities for formative feedback.
Careers or Further Progression

Expand+Graduate employers
Graduates from this course are now working for:
• Belfast Opera House
• Big Telly Theatre Company
• Health & Social Care Trusts
• Kabosh Productions
• Lyric Theatre
• The Derry Playhouse
• BBC
